#[allow(dead_code)]
pub struct Backoff {
jitter: f64,
next_backoff: f64,
max_backoff: f64,
multiplier: f64,
}
impl Default for Backoff {
fn default() -> Self {
Self {
jitter: 0.5,
next_backoff: 0.,
max_backoff: 5.,
multiplier: 3.,
}
}
}
impl Iterator for Backoff {
type Item = Duration;
fn next(&mut self) -> Option<Self::Item> {
let jitter: f64 = rng().random_range(-self.jitter..self.jitter);
let mut backoff = (self.next_backoff + jitter).min(self.max_backoff);
backoff = backoff.max(0.);
self.next_backoff = (self.next_backoff * self.multiplier).min(self.max_backoff);
Some(Duration::from_secs_f64(backoff))
}
}
